Ranch-era fireplaces, upgraded and swept
Clyde's 1960s-to-80s ranch and split-level homes were built with fireplaces that were fine for their day and are dated now — often shallow, inefficient masonry boxes or aging prefab units. A lot of these are ripe for a wood insert that turns a heat-losing hole in the wall into a genuine heater, and when that upgrade goes in, the maintenance clock resets to a stove's schedule, not an open fireplace's. An insert holding a slow fire condenses creosote on its liner faster than an open fire that mostly roars its heat up the chimney, so the yearly sweep becomes more important after the upgrade, not less. The annual inspection is also where a decades-old flue gets checked for the cracks and gaps that ranch-era chimneys tend to develop.
Damp valley, rusting hardware
Clyde sits in the same Pigeon River valley system as Canton and Waynesville, where cold air drains down and settles and river humidity lingers — conditions that rust dampers and chimney caps and degrade masonry faster than a drier hillside would. That moisture also mixes with creosote to form a harder glaze, so what looks like a light soot layer can be tougher to remove than it appears. We measure against the eighth-inch cleaning line and grade the glaze during the inspection, and booking that visit in late summer means the stove is clean and checked before Haywood's cold arrives early.
